Understanding the Issue
The Rise of YouTube to MP3 Converters
With the proliferation of online content consumption, particularly on YouTube, users sought convenient ways to extract audio from videos for offline listening. This gave rise to YouTube to MP3 converter websites, offering a seemingly effortless solution to convert videos into audio files.
Google's Response
In response to the surge in popularity of these converter websites, Google has intensified its efforts to combat copyright infringement and protect the rights of content creators. One of the primary targets of this crackdown is the ecosystem of YouTube to MP3 converter platforms.
The Legality Conundrum
Copyright Infringement Concerns
The crux of the issue lies in the violation of copyright laws inherent in the conversion of YouTube videos to MP3 files without proper authorization. By extracting and distributing copyrighted audio content without permission, these converter websites are infringing upon the intellectual property rights of artists and content creators.
Legal Ramifications for Users
While the legal implications for users of these converter services may vary depending on jurisdiction, engaging in unauthorized downloading of copyrighted material can potentially expose individuals to legal consequences, including fines and penalties.
Exploring Alternatives
Licensed Streaming Platforms
In light of the crackdown on YouTube to MP3 converter websites, users are encouraged to explore legal and licensed streaming platforms that offer a vast library of music content for both streaming and offline listening. Platforms like Spotify, Apple Music, and Amazon Music provide convenient and affordable alternatives while respecting copyright laws.
